Why Liberty Village clients choose Kopman Build

Liberty Village is one of Toronto's most active condo renovation markets. The neighbourhood's stock spans early-1900s brick-and-beam factory conversions — now prized hard loft suites — and a wave of newer high-rise towers that have drawn young professionals in large numbers. Each building type presents distinct GC challenges that require the right preparation before a single trade sets foot on site.

Three things set Liberty Village construction apart. First, loft structural complexity: many converted industrial buildings have post-and-beam or concrete-frame systems that need engineering review before any walls are reconfigured — we identify this at scope stage, not mid-build. Second, dense urban logistics: deliveries to King Street West sites require pre-booked freight access, tight staging, and waste removal coordinated so it never blocks neighbours — we plan this from day one. Third, condo board compliance: both legacy loft buildings and newer tower corporations have their own renovation rules, and we prepare and submit every required document before work begins so approvals never delay your schedule.

Questions about general contractor Liberty Village

What general contracting work is common in Liberty Village?

Liberty Village is dominated by converted industrial loft buildings and newer high-rise condo towers, so the most common general contracting work involves loft suite renovations, open-concept reconfigurations, condo unit gut-renos, and interior fit-outs. Projects often require coordination with building management and strict adherence to condo corporation rules around working hours, elevator bookings, and trade access.

How does condo board approval affect a renovation in Liberty Village?

Most Liberty Village buildings require prior approval from the condo corporation before any structural, plumbing, or electrical work begins. This typically means submitting contractor credentials, proof of insurance, and detailed scope drawings. Kopman Build handles this documentation as part of our pre-construction process, so your building management has everything they need before work starts.

Can a general contractor work inside a Liberty Village loft or condo without a permit?

Some cosmetic work — flooring, painting, cabinet replacement — does not require a City of Toronto permit. However, any changes to structural elements, plumbing rough-in, electrical panels, or HVAC require permits regardless of the building type. Kopman Build assesses permit requirements at the scope stage and manages all applications so nothing is missed.
